The Daitian method began during the reign of Emperor Xiaowu. Zhao Guo, the captain of the mill-searching team, summarized and improved it based on the production technology and experience of farmers in Guanzhong, and then promoted the farming methods all over the world. This method mainly uses oxen and plows on a square field.

Dig three soil trenches and sow the seeds in the trenches. After the leaves germinate, the soil on both sides of the trenches is gradually filled into the roots of the crops. This will provide wind and drought resistance, drainage and flood prevention.

Since the location of the ditch rotates every year, it is called Daida.
